Registration is now open for the 20 Years of LALP Impact Events, a milestone celebration of Georgetown University’s Latin America Leadership Program (LALP). As part of this commemorative week, LALP will host a one-day Forum on Friday, November 6, at the Lohrfink Auditorium, McDonough School of Business. Open to the entire Georgetown University community and external guests, the Forum will bring together leaders, scholars, and partners to exchange knowledge, reflect on shared regional challenges, and explore new opportunities for collaboration across the Americas.
